Certificate in Foundations of Management

Organizations require professionals who grasp fundamental business concepts like accounting, finance, marketing, and leadership, and can effectively apply them in their roles. The 4-course Foundations of Management graduate certificate allows students to build a solid business foundation that enhances their specialized field of study. Credits earned may be transferred into an online MBA or MSBA program.

Certificate in Forensic Accounting

Follow the money: Fraud investigations, auditing, and complex decision-making all demand the ability to trace financial transaction patterns and spot inconsistencies. Accounting and finance professionals can acquire these skills through Isenberg’s 12-credit Graduate Certificate in Forensic Accounting. Credits earned may be transferred into the MSA program.

MS in Accounting Transitions Track

The Isenberg MS in Accounting Transitions Track is designed to help students build fundamental accounting skills before moving on to advanced concepts such as auditing, tax, financial valuation, and exploring ethical standards. Students can choose from three areas of specialized knowledge: Data Analytics, Forensic Accounting, and Taxation.

MS in Accounting - Professional Track

Isenberg’s MS in Accounting degree equips students for all aspects of accounting and auditing, including tax implications, financial valuation, ethical standards, and changing technologies. Students can choose from three areas of specialized knowledge: Data Analytics, Forensic Accounting, and Taxation. Students located in the Amherst area can earn the degree on campus or through a mix of on-campus and online coursework.
